Major Breakthroughs in Modern Astronomy
New Planet Discoveries
One of the most exciting aspects of astronomy news is the discovery of exoplanets—planets orbiting stars outside our solar system. Thousands have been identified, some located in the “habitable zone,” where conditions might support liquid water.
These discoveries raise profound questions about whether life exists elsewhere in the universe and how planetary systems form.
Black Hole Research
Black holes were once purely theoretical, but recent observations have transformed them into one of the hottest topics in astronomy news.
The groundbreaking image of a black hole captured by the Event Horizon Telescope Collaboration provided direct visual evidence of these mysterious objects. Scientists continue studying their gravitational effects, mergers, and role in galaxy evolution.
Advances in Telescope Technology
Modern telescopes are revolutionizing astronomy. Instruments such as the James Webb Space Telescope allow scientists to observe distant galaxies, star formation, and atmospheric compositions of exoplanets with unprecedented detail.
These tools are pushing the boundaries of how far back in time we can observe, offering glimpses into the early universe.
Space Missions Shaping the Future
Robotic Exploration
Robotic missions remain at the forefront of astronomy news. Rovers and probes explore planets, moons, and asteroids, collecting data that helps scientists understand the solar system’s history.
For example, missions studying Mars aim to determine whether the planet once hosted microbial life and whether it could support human exploration in the future.
Human Spaceflight
Human spaceflight is experiencing a resurgence. International collaboration and private sector involvement are accelerating plans for long-duration missions.
Programs like lunar exploration initiatives aim to establish a sustainable presence beyond Earth, paving the way for future journeys to Mars and beyond.

Emerging Trends in Space Science
Commercial Space Industry
The rise of private companies is one of the most significant developments in astronomy news. Commercial launches, satellite networks, and space tourism are reshaping the economics of space exploration.
This shift is reducing costs and enabling more frequent missions, which accelerates scientific discovery.
Planetary Defense
Monitoring near-Earth objects has become a priority. Scientists track asteroids and comets that could pose a collision risk.
Research into deflection technologies aims to ensure humanity is prepared for potential threats.
Search for Extraterrestrial Life
The search for life beyond Earth remains one of astronomy’s most compelling pursuits. Scientists analyze planetary atmospheres for biosignatures—chemical indicators that might suggest biological activity.
Future missions will expand these efforts, bringing us closer to answering one of humanity’s oldest questions: Are we alone?
